Clippio is a marketplace where campaign owners fund clipping campaigns and creators (clippers) get paid per view. This policy explains what we collect, why, and what we never touch. The short version: we collect the minimum needed to run campaigns and verify views, we never see your passwords or your money, and everything designed to be public on Clippio is stated as public below.
1. What we collect
- Wallet address. Used as your identity for payouts and, for owners, for funding campaigns. We never receive or store private keys.
- Connected social accounts. When you connect an account through the platform's official login (for example TikTok Login Kit or Google sign-in), we receive basic profile information (display name, avatar, account identifier) and, for content you submit to a campaign, its public engagement metrics (view, like, comment and share counts). Access tokens are stored encrypted and used only for the purposes below.
- Campaign and submission data. Campaign briefs, banners and requirements from owners; links to public posts from clippers.
- Email address (owners only). If you log in to manage campaigns, we store your email and use it solely for login codes and essential service messages. Clippers never need an account or an email.
- Technical data. Standard server logs (IP address, browser type, timestamps) for security and debugging.
2. What we never collect
- Passwords. Connections use each platform's official OAuth; your credentials never pass through Clippio.
- Private keys or funds. Payments happen on Solana, signed in your own wallet or executed by an on-chain program. Clippio never holds money.
- Private messages, contact lists, followers lists or any content beyond what is listed above.
3. Data from TikTok and other connected platforms
Data obtained through TikTok Login Kit and the TikTok Display API (and the equivalent APIs of YouTube, Instagram or X) is used for exactly two purposes: verifying that you own the account you submit content from, and retrieving the public engagement metrics of the specific videos you submit to campaigns, so payouts can be computed. We do not post on your behalf, we do not access private content, and we do not use this data for advertising or sell it to anyone. You can disconnect a platform at any time, which revokes and deletes the stored access token. Our use of platform data complies with each platform's developer terms, including TikTok's Developer Terms of Service.
4. How we use data
- Running campaigns: showing submissions to owners, computing payouts from view counts, tracking budgets.
- Fraud prevention: engagement and velocity analysis to flag manipulated views.
- Security, debugging and support.
5. What is public by design
Clippio is built on transparency, so some data is intentionally public: campaign pages and their stats, submissions and their view counts, owner payment records (campaigns paid, time to pay, unpaid approved balances), leaderboards, and everything that lives on the Solana blockchain (wallet addresses, vault balances, transactions). Blockchain data is public and permanent by nature and cannot be deleted by us or anyone.
6. Sharing
We do not sell personal data. We share data only with infrastructure providers needed to run the service (hosting, RPC providers), when the law requires it, or when it is public by design as described above.
7. Retention and deletion
Social connections and their tokens are deleted when you disconnect. You can request deletion of your account data at any time through the contact below; we will delete everything except what we are legally required to keep and what is permanently recorded on-chain.
8. Security
Tokens are stored encrypted, access is limited, and the payment design itself is the biggest safeguard: there are no custodial funds to steal, because we never hold any.
